    No troubles for the Cavaliers in their opening game of this season's playoffs in basketball's NBA


    The Eastern Conference top seeds have produced a strong final quarter to claim a 121 to 100 win over Miami in Cleveland.

    In earlier opening playoff fixtures - Oklahoma City thrashed Memphis and Boston beat Orlando.
